Pre-Cleaning and Surface Preparation

Before applying antiviral disinfectants, surfaces must be cleaned to remove dirt, grease, and debris. Organic matter can reduce the effectiveness of sanitising agents. Professional teams use appropriate cleaning solutions to prepare each area. This step ensures disinfectants can work directly on surface contaminants.

Pre-cleaning includes vacuuming carpets where needed, wiping down hard surfaces, and removing visible residues. It also involves isolating sensitive equipment that requires careful handling. This preparation phase is essential because disinfectants perform best on clean surfaces. Skipping this stage may reduce overall sanitisation effectiveness.

Application of Approved Antiviral Disinfectants

Once surfaces are prepared, technicians apply hospital-grade antiviral disinfectants. These products are selected based on safety regulations and effectiveness against common viruses. Application methods vary depending on the environment and surface type. Some areas require manual wiping, while others benefit from misting or fogging systems.

Proper dwell time is critical during this stage. Disinfectants must remain on surfaces for a specified period to achieve maximum viral reduction. Professional providers monitor this carefully to ensure compliance. This structured approach distinguishes antiviral sanitisation from general cleaning routines.

Fogging and Advanced Disinfection Methods

In certain cases, fogging technology is used to enhance surface coverage. Fogging disperses fine disinfectant particles into the air, allowing them to settle on hard-to-reach areas. This method supports comprehensive sanitisation in larger or complex spaces. It is particularly useful in offices, schools, and healthcare-related settings.

Fogging does not replace manual cleaning. Instead, it complements direct surface disinfection for broader coverage. Professional operators ensure ventilation and safety protocols are followed during application. Difference Between Routine Cleaning and Antiviral Sanitisation

Routine cleaning focuses on removing dirt and maintaining visible cleanliness. Antiviral sanitisation, however, prioritises microbial reduction through disinfectant use. While both are important, they serve different purposes within property maintenance. Sanitisation is typically performed after cleaning has been completed.
